Business is so good it doesn't matter. Their bottom line does not improve if they sell something at a discount today that they could sell at full price next week. The amount of volume that is moving on a daily basis would blow most people's minds. They don't need to do real discounts. That would just be giving away their profits for no reason.

I tried telling people this in the hockey forum lol like these companies aren’t so desperate they have to sell you good to ok product at a discount to survive. Everyday for some reason some old product sports or non-sports goes up in price due to demand, scarcity, someone in set that gains popularity etc, the same people you hear reminiscing on the old days when they got a full case of Optic Megas for cheap are why you don’t see great sales lol now that cards are just part of pop culture there never gonna leave that type of money on the table again. Add to the fact “Black Friday” actually did used to be about the name, now again that’s just part of pop culture but everyone wants sales like a place is going out of business lol when I think nowadays everyone just participates because it’s a thing, not due to demand or necessity so they just do the bare minimum to be part of the “day” as they would be just fine if a Black Friday didn’t exist.
